Output 83166933eb4c43aa8890c01c94dccf21e7a0ddacfd8a138462739dc7c153407a:9

value
344859861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94a7af267e05da6217946462efbd666e26ad0b03 OP_EQUAL
address
MMTB7iqteUA5xAiUefYDnTgB7CHnP15fET
transaction
83166933eb4c43aa8890c01c94dccf21e7a0ddacfd8a138462739dc7c153407a
spent
true